Vouchers for experimenting, researching and discovering

The goal of the project “RWE Foundation Education Vouchers with Junior-Uni Ruhr” is to support particularly eager and interested children and adolescents from families with poor educational backgrounds via extracurricular courses, where they may experience new educational opportunities.

The courses range from planetary research to complex robotics teachings. The project begins with Junior-Uni Ruhr teachers teaching children in selected nurseries, primary and secondary schools in socially disadvantaged areas. In the second step, teachers will select children with a particular willingness and interest to learn, who will be awarded with educational vouchers. They may use these to attend different courses in Junior-Uni in Mülheim for free. This way, children and adolescents get to experience new forms of education, and previously hidden talents and abilities will be found and promoted.
